Uses of Interface
com.evolveum.midpoint.prism.delta.PrismValueDeltaSetTriple
Packages that use PrismValueDeltaSetTriple
Package
Description
-
Uses of PrismValueDeltaSetTriple in com.evolveum.midpoint.model.api.context
Methods in com.evolveum.midpoint.model.api.context that return PrismValueDeltaSetTriple -
Uses of PrismValueDeltaSetTriple in com.evolveum.midpoint.prism.deleg
Methods in com.evolveum.midpoint.prism.deleg that return PrismValueDeltaSetTripleModifier and TypeMethodDescriptiondefault PrismValueDeltaSetTriple<V>ItemDeltaDelegator.toDeltaSetTriple(Item<V, D> itemOld) -
Uses of PrismValueDeltaSetTriple in com.evolveum.midpoint.prism.delta
Methods in com.evolveum.midpoint.prism.delta that return PrismValueDeltaSetTripleModifier and TypeMethodDescriptionstatic <V extends PrismValue>
PrismValueDeltaSetTriple<V>DeltaSetTripleUtil.allToZeroSet(Collection<V> values) PrismValueDeltaSetTriple.clone()<V extends PrismValue>
PrismValueDeltaSetTriple<V>DeltaFactory.createPrismValueDeltaSetTriple()<V extends PrismValue>
PrismValueDeltaSetTriple<V>DeltaFactory.createPrismValueDeltaSetTriple(Collection<V> zeroSet, Collection<V> plusSet, Collection<V> minusSet) static <V extends PrismValue>
PrismValueDeltaSetTriple<V>DeltaSetTripleUtil.diffPrismValueDeltaSetTriple(Collection<V> valuesOld, Collection<V> valuesNew) Compares two (unordered) collections and creates a triple describing the differences.ItemDelta.toDeltaSetTriple(Item<V, D> itemOld) static <IV extends PrismValue,ID extends ItemDefinition<?>>
PrismValueDeltaSetTriple<IV>ItemDeltaUtil.toDeltaSetTriple(Item<IV, ID> itemOld, ItemDelta<IV, ID> delta) Converts the old state of an item and the delta into "plus/minus/zero" information.static <O extends Objectable>
PrismValueDeltaSetTriple<PrismObjectValue<O>>ItemDeltaUtil.toDeltaSetTriple(PrismObject<O> objectOld, ObjectDelta<O> delta) TheItemDeltaUtil.toDeltaSetTriple(Item, ItemDelta)for whole objects.ObjectDelta.toDeltaSetTriple(PrismObject<O> objectOld) CreatesPrismValueDeltaSetTriple(plus/minus/zero sets) for the value ofPrismObject.Methods in com.evolveum.midpoint.prism.delta with parameters of type PrismValueDeltaSetTripleModifier and TypeMethodDescription<O extends PrismValue>
voidPrismValueDeltaSetTriple.distributeAs(V myMember, PrismValueDeltaSetTriple<O> otherTriple, O otherMember) Distributes a value in this triple similar to the placement of other value in the other triple. -
Uses of PrismValueDeltaSetTriple in com.evolveum.midpoint.prism.extensions
Classes in com.evolveum.midpoint.prism.extensions that implement PrismValueDeltaSetTripleModifier and TypeClassDescriptionclassFields in com.evolveum.midpoint.prism.extensions declared as PrismValueDeltaSetTripleModifier and TypeFieldDescriptionprotected PrismValueDeltaSetTriple<V>AbstractDelegatedPrismValueDeltaSetTriple.innerMethods in com.evolveum.midpoint.prism.extensions that return PrismValueDeltaSetTripleMethods in com.evolveum.midpoint.prism.extensions with parameters of type PrismValueDeltaSetTripleModifier and TypeMethodDescription<O extends PrismValue>
voidAbstractDelegatedPrismValueDeltaSetTriple.distributeAs(V myMember, PrismValueDeltaSetTriple<O> otherTriple, O otherMember) Constructors in com.evolveum.midpoint.prism.extensions with parameters of type PrismValueDeltaSetTripleModifierConstructorDescription -
Uses of PrismValueDeltaSetTriple in com.evolveum.midpoint.prism.util
Methods in com.evolveum.midpoint.prism.util that return PrismValueDeltaSetTripleMethods in com.evolveum.midpoint.prism.util with parameters of type PrismValueDeltaSetTripleModifier and TypeMethodDescriptionstatic <T,V extends PrismValue>
voidPrismAsserts.assertTripleMinus(PrismValueDeltaSetTriple<V> triple, T... expectedValues) static <T,V extends PrismValue>
voidPrismAsserts.assertTriplePlus(PrismValueDeltaSetTriple<V> triple, T... expectedValues) static <T,V extends PrismValue>
voidPrismAsserts.assertTripleZero(PrismValueDeltaSetTriple<V> triple, T... expectedValues) -
Uses of PrismValueDeltaSetTriple in com.evolveum.prism.xml.ns._public.types_3
Methods in com.evolveum.prism.xml.ns._public.types_3 with parameters of type PrismValueDeltaSetTripleModifier and TypeMethodDescriptionstatic <V extends PrismValue>
DeltaSetTripleTypeDeltaSetTripleType.fromDeltaSetTriple(PrismValueDeltaSetTriple<V> triple)